General Summary
The Account Technician performs all accounting and finance-related functions for the residents’ accounts at Crossroads ATC in a timely and accurate manner in accordance to generally accepted accounting principles as well as fiscal directives and set mandates by the Illinois Department of Corrections (IDOC), as well as providing back-up to the security, program, and administrative staff functions.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
- Accurately inputs financial data onto individual residents` accounts
- Reconciles individual trust accounts in preparation for close-out due to parole or revocation
- Prepares monies received for bank deposits daily; clearly and concisely presents the "financial management class" to new residents at the ATC
- Processes check requests in accordance with approved accounting procedures
- Prepares and distributes daily, weekly, and monthly error-free financial reports
- Participates in the internal and external fiscal auditing process by keeping abreast of current IDOC fiscal directives
- Provides back-up to the security, program, and administrative staff functions, as needed
